91香蕉视频 promotes online safety during Cybersecurity Awareness Month

The West Virginia School of Osteopathic Medicine (91香蕉视频) announced its commitment to Cybersecurity Awareness Month, held annually in October, by becoming a 鈥淐hampion鈥 and joining a global effort to promote the awareness of online safety and privacy.

The Cybersecurity Awareness Month Champions Program is a collaborative effort among businesses, government agencies, colleges and universities, associations, nonprofit organizations and individuals committed to this year鈥檚 Cybersecurity Awareness Month theme of 鈥淒o Your Part. #BeCyberSmart.鈥 The program鈥檚 goal is to empower individuals and organizations to own their role in protecting their part of cyberspace.

The initiative also highlights the importance of keeping connected devices safe and secure from outside influence. Data collected from these devices can include specific information about a person or business that can be exploited for personal gain.

Kim Ransom, 91香蕉视频鈥檚 chief technology officer, said 91香蕉视频 faces cybersecurity threats on a regular basis, but that the medical school strives to give members of its community the knowledge required to successfully confront them.

鈥淐ybersecurity issues impact 91香蕉视频 daily. They range from international hacking attempts 鈥 most recently against our website from servers in the Eastern European country of Moldova 鈥 to phishing attempts sent to employees by entitles posing as members of the school鈥檚 administration,鈥 Ransom said. 鈥淥ne of our best defenses is increasing awareness among staff and students. By not clicking on phishing attempts and reporting email scams to the information technology department, we can jointly block these threats.鈥

91香蕉视频鈥檚 cybersecurity protocols are audited annually, with the most recent audit taking place from April to June 2020. In preparation, the school鈥檚 IT department formulated an Information Security Plan highlighting 91香蕉视频鈥檚 measures to comply with the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act, a federal law that includes provisions requiring institutions to protect financial data. The plan also requires annual employee training for data protection, the appropriate processing and disposal of data, and detecting, preventing and responding to cybersecurity attacks.

Cybersecurity Awareness Month, led by the National Cyber Security Alliance and the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Agency of the U.S. Department of Homeland Security, aims to shed light on security vulnerabilities and offer guidance on simple safety measures.
